We would like to inform you that Kosuke OTA, a player belonging to our club, has decided to transfer completely to Nagoya Grampus.
We plan to have an interaction with fans and supporters on July 15 (Monday, public holiday) at Kodaira Ground. Details will be announced as soon as they are finalized.
【Kosuke OTA Player Profile】
□Position: DF
□Date of Birth: July 23, 1987
□Place of Origin: Machida City, Tokyo
□Height/Weight: 178cm/78kg
□Blood Type: Type A
□Career:
2003-2005 Azabu University附属Fuchinobe High School
2006-2008 Yokohama FC
2009-2011 Shimizu S-Pulse
2011 J.League Excellent Player Award, J.League Fair Play Individual Award
2012-2015 FC Tokyo
2013 J.League Excellent Player Award
2014 J.League Excellent Player Award, J.League Best Eleven
2015 J.League Excellent Player Award, J.League Best Eleven
2016 SBV Vitesse Arnhem (Netherlands Division 1)
2017-2019.6 FC Tokyo
□Representative History:
2007 U-20 Japan national team (FIFA U-20 World Cup Canada Best 16)
2010 Japan national team (AFC Asian Cup Final Qualifiers Participation)
2014 Japan national team
2015 Japan national team
2016 Japan national team
* Japan national team international A match appearances: 7 matches, 0 goals (as of July 2, 2019)

□Kosuke OTA Comment
To everyone who loves FC Tokyo. I have decided to transfer to Nagoya Grampus. I sincerely apologize for leaving the team at this timing when we are at the top of the league.
Joining in 2012 and being able to play in the blue and red uniform at Ajinomoto Stadium for six and a half years has become a great treasure in my football life. The happy moments and the frustrating ones, every single moment of those six and a half years is a valuable asset to me.
I am grateful that I have received maximum appreciation from Tokyo, and while I had the desire to continue playing with my beloved club and my beloved teammates, I gradually felt a stronger desire to grow more as a player and to stand on the pitch. Therefore, I have decided to challenge myself in a new environment this time.
I am proud to have shared invaluable time with the best fans, supporters, players, and staff. I cannot thank the great blue-red fans and supporters enough for always supporting us players, no matter the circumstances.
It was a difficult decision, but I want to apply what I learned at FC Tokyo to my future life.
Thank you very much for the past six and a half years
